#!/usr/bin/env python3
import pycriu
import sys
import os
import subprocess
find = subprocess.Popen(
['find', 'test/dump/', '-size', '+0', '-name', '*.img'],
stdout=subprocess.PIPE)
test_pass = True
def recode_and_check(imgf, o_img, pretty):
try:
pb = pycriu.images.loads(o_img, pretty)
except pycriu.images.MagicException as me:
print("%s magic %x error" % (imgf, me.magic))
return False
except Exception as e:
print("%s %sdecode fails: %s" % (imgf, pretty and 'pretty ' or '', e))
return False
try:
r_img = pycriu.images.dumps(pb)
except Exception as e:
r_img = pycriu.images.dumps(pb)
print("%s %s encode fails: %s" % (imgf, pretty and 'pretty ' or '', e))
return False
if o_img != r_img:
print("%s %s recode mismatch" % (imgf, pretty and 'pretty ' or ''))
return False
return True
for imgf in find.stdout.readlines():
imgf = imgf.strip()
imgf_b = os.path.basename(imgf)
if imgf_b.startswith(b'pages-'):
continue
if imgf_b.startswith(b'iptables-'):
continue
if imgf_b.startswith(b'ip6tables-'):
continue
if imgf_b.startswith(b'nftables-'):
continue
if imgf_b.startswith(b'route-'):
continue
if imgf_b.startswith(b'route6-'):
continue
if imgf_b.startswith(b'ifaddr-'):
continue
if imgf_b.startswith(b'tmpfs-'):
continue
if imgf_b.startswith(b'netns-ct-'):
continue
if imgf_b.startswith(b'netns-exp-'):
continue
if imgf_b.startswith(b'rule-'):
continue
o_img = open(imgf.decode(), "rb").read()
if not recode_and_check(imgf, o_img, False):
test_pass = False
if not recode_and_check(imgf, o_img, True):
test_pass = False
find.wait()
if not test_pass:
print("FAIL")
sys.exit(1)
print("PASS")
